Innovations Shaping the Food Storage Container Market Worldwide
The food storage container industry plays a crucial role in ensuring the safe preservation, transportation, and distribution of food products. These containers are essential for maintaining food quality, preventing spoilage, and extending shelf life, especially in today’s fast-paced lifestyles. Demand is driven by growing urbanization, rising disposable incomes, and the increasing preference for packaged and ready-to-eat meals. Additionally, innovations in materials, such as biodegradable plastics and advanced polymers, are shaping the market’s future.
The Food Storage Container Market is witnessing significant growth due to the rising demand for sustainable packaging solutions and stringent food safety regulations. Consumers are now more conscious of eco-friendly options, prompting manufacturers to focus on recyclable and reusable container designs. Furthermore, the foodservice sector’s expansion, along with a surge in online food delivery services, has boosted demand for high-quality and durable storage solutions. Advanced features like airtight sealing, microwave compatibility, and temperature resistance are becoming key differentiators in the industry.
Asia-Pacific dominates the market, driven by high consumption rates, increasing food exports, and a growing middle-class population. North America and Europe also hold substantial shares, with their focus on sustainability and advanced packaging technologies. The market is competitive, with companies investing in research to improve material safety, product designs, and efficiency in manufacturing processes.
Future growth prospects remain promising as the demand for healthy, fresh, and safe food continues to rise globally. Technological advancements in smart packaging, integration of tracking systems for supply chains, and the shift towards bio-based plastics are expected to shape industry dynamics in the coming years. As consumer awareness grows and food safety standards tighten, the food storage container industry will play an even more pivotal role in global food supply chains.
